I-tube ye-sapphire isakhiwo se-cylindrical esenziwe kwi-sapphire, eyindidi ye-mineral corundum.Iityhubhu zeSapphire ziyaziwa ngobulukhuni bazo obukhethekileyo, ukuguquguquka okuphezulu kwe-thermal, kunye neempawu ezibalaseleyo zokukhanya.Zihlala zisetyenziselwa ubushushu obuphezulu kunye noxinzelelo oluphezulu, njengakwi-aerospace, i-semiconductor, kunye namashishini amachiza.

Iipropathi zetyhubhu yesafire ziyenza ilungele ukusetyenziswa kwiindawo ezigqithisileyo apho ezinye izinto zinokusilela.Iyakwazi ukumelana namaqondo okushisa aphezulu, ukubola, kunye nokugqoka, okwenza kube yinto ebalulekileyo kwizicelo ezifana neetyhubhu zesithando somlilo, iityhubhu zokukhusela i-thermocouple, kunye ne-high-pressure kunye ne-high-temperature sensors.

Ukongeza kwiipropathi zayo zomatshini kunye ne-thermal, ukukhanya kwesafire kwi-spectrum ebonakalayo kunye ne-infrared spectrum kwenza ukuba kube luncedo kwizicelo apho kufuneka ukufikelela kwi-optical, njengeenkqubo ze-laser, izixhobo zokuhlola ukukhanya, kunye namagumbi ophando aphezulu.

Ngokubanzi, iityhubhu zesafire zixatyiswe ngokudityaniswa kwamandla oomatshini, ukuxhathisa kwe-thermal, kunye nokubonakala kwe-optical transparency, kubenza babe ngamacandelo ahlukeneyo kwizicelo ezahlukeneyo zemizi-mveliso nezesayensi.

Iipropati zetyhubhu yesafire

  • Ubushushu obugqwesileyo kunye nokumelana noxinzelelo: ityhubhu yethu yesafire isetyenziswa kumaqondo obushushu aphezulu ukuya kuthi ga kwi-1900 ° C.
  • Ubulukhuni obuphezulu kunye nokuqina: Ukuqina kwetyhubhu yethu yesafire ukuya kuthi ga kwi-Mohs9, kunye nokunganyangeki okuqinileyo.
  • I-airtight kakhulu: I-tube yethu ye-sapphire yenziwe kwi-molding enye kunye ne-teknoloji yobunini kwaye i-100% ingena moya, ikhusela ukungena kwegesi eseleyo kunye nokuxhathisa kwi-corrosion ye-chemical gas.
  • Indawo ebanzi yesicelo: ityhubhu yethu yesafire ingasetyenziselwa ukusetyenziswa kwesibane kwizixhobo ezahlukeneyo zokuhlalutya kwaye inokuhambisa ukukhanya okubonakalayo, i-infrared okanye i-ultraviolet, kwaye isetyenziswe njengesikhundla somgangatho we-quartz, i-alumina kunye ne-silicon carbide kwi-semiconductor processing applications.

ityhubhu yesafire yesiko:

Idayimitha yangaphandle Φ1.5~400mm
idiameter yangaphakathi Φ0.5~300mm
ubude 2-800mm
udonga lwangaphakathi 0.5-300mm
ukunyamezelana +/-0.02 ~+/- 0.1mm
uburhabaxa 40/20~80/50

 

ubukhulu eyenzelwe wena
Indawo yokunyibilika 1900℃
ifomula yemichiza isafire
ukuxinana 3.97 gm/cc
ubulukhuni 22.5 GPA
amandla okuguquguquka 690 MPa
amandla edielectric 48 ac V/mm
I-dielectric rhoqo 9.3 (@ 1MHz)
umthamo wokumelana 10^14 ohm-cm
